MWg, previously know as O2 Asia, introduces the Zinc II PDA Phone. The phone is in fact the successor of O2’s Zinc. The company has released the Atom V before.
The MWg Zinc II is powered by a Samsung 500MHz processor, 256MB Flash ROM and 64MB RAM. It has a slide-out QWERTY keyboard.
Zinc II comes with also a 2.8-inch LCD touchscreen, a 2 Megapixel camera and support for quad-band GSM and HSDPA high-speed data. As for connectivity, the Zinc II features WiFi 802.11b/g, Bluetooth as well as GPS with the SIRF StarIII chipset. It has also a microSD card slot for expansion.
The MWg Zinc II runs Windows Mobile 6.1 Professional OS.
